I agree with the previous poster if you are one that is inclined to tinker around with settings etc...post install, BM3 would be a good platform for you.

However if are a set it and forget it type of person MP is a great solution...they have tuned my last several cars and I couldn't be happier.

All the major flash tuners (BM3, MHD, Carbauhn, MP) are going to give you about the same level of performance +/-

Given we are both in SoCal - I really enjoy the fact that I can go to the MP shop (Rancho Cucamonga) should I need or want to. I can also pick up the phone and speak with Alex. Having a world class tuner in our backyard that we have physical access to is something special. And is something I certainly took into consideration when making my decision about who I was going to send my money to.

All AWE exhaust options eliminate the factory valve. This is because the factory valve is post muffler - and all the AWE options eliminate or replace the muffler.

I am running a catted DP through my stock muffler and it is pretty aggressive in sport + and quiets down nicely in comfort.

Depending on your tolerance for loud exhausts if you know you are going to do a DP - I would do that first through the stock muffler, see what you think and then go for the exhaust if you want things louder (or you want quad tips etc..).

Keep in mind the stock M340 exhaust is dual piped and non resonated from the DP to the muffler. So things can get loud real quick :-)
